RESUMEN

Trichosporon spp. are yeasts capable of causing invasive disease, which mainly affect immunocompromised patients. A clinical strain of T. asahii was isolated from the blood cultures of patients admitted to the General Hospital of Fortaleza. Susceptibility tests were conducted by disk diffusion and broth microdilution. The isolated strain of T. asahii was resistant to fluconazole. The patient used amphotericin B and caspofungin in order to facilitate the microbiological cure. It was the first isolation and identification of T. asahii in blood culture in Ceará, Brazil.

RESUMEN

The purpose of this paper is to examine the pH adaptability range of two yeasts from our laboratory,and applied turbidimetry and Bradford methods to examine growth of Trichosporon asahii XJU-1 and Rhodotorula mucilaginosa XJU-1.It is shown that Trichosporon asahii XJU-1 grown between pH2.0 and pH13.0 and optimum pH is 8.0,whereas Rhodotorula mucilaginosa XJU-1 grown between pH3.0 and 12.0,optimum pH is 8.5.When turbidimetry was applied,it produced consensus results between pH4.0 and 10.0 with Bradford method.At the same time,produced senior distorted at pH
